I’m super excited to be able to share some images of the final design. There’s been a lot of iterations, I honestly haven’t been able to keep track of the evolution from the beginning. I want to say I sat down at the computer around March 2022 and started trying to remember the basics of CAD - Literally started from ground zero, trying to remember the basics of axis and plane orientation, how to extrude a shapes, it was a little rough at first.

While technically I am an enginerd, I haven’t dabbled in any kind of CAD software since my early undergrad 13+ years ago. It’s remarkable all the information on the internet today on which programs to use, video tutorials, etc. Super grateful for all the resources out there. It was quite overwhelming on which program to go with, so many choices and opinions on which is the best. The options range from free web-based softwares all the way up to design industry standards where you could literally design and build a space shuttle. I went the basic route and went with a free web-based software for starting out. The two primary reasons being:

1. the amount of time it would take to get proficient enough with a higher end software I may still be lost in the woods trying figure out how to draw a 3D object

2. the costs for industry standard software was more than I could justify at the time for stage the stage the idea was at.

I’m not trying to talk folks out of using those higher end softwares or talk down on them, they absolutely have their place and I encountered complications down the design path due to the limitations of the simple web based programs that would’ve been avoided had I gone the space shuttle route. Like everything in life there are pro’s and con’s and those have to be considered prior to making a decision, there’s never a golden arrow will do everything perfectly.
